Output 65ce83a868f0d5e9b71e31c1238c2c7e90a005904436f9b491c26718bec4f27a:0

value
770656673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6921a214f0348627a8344b4a2e3db7002ed72fc4 OP_EQUAL
address
3BGuAZFkmc85hfmgvc3mW75vC6fg9nxzd7
transaction
65ce83a868f0d5e9b71e31c1238c2c7e90a005904436f9b491c26718bec4f27a
spent
true